    Steam provides a digital distribution platform for games with streaming, mod support, and multiplayer capabilities. Developed by Valve, it supports over 100 payment methods, includes Early Access, cloud sync, controller support for major brands, and offers an integrated gaming community.

    Intuitive interface for managing software on Windows through WinGet, Scoop, Chocolatey, Pip, Npm, .NET Tool, and PowerShell Gallery. Offers bulk install, detailed metadata, custom options, auto-updates, tray notifications, filtering, backups, and restore features.

    Browse, discover, and install GitHub project releases with an open-source app store showing only repos with actual installable assets. Features single-click installs, automatic platform detection, changelogs, stat-rich details, and cross-platform support for Android and desktop.
